12ADVANCED GRAPHICS
This chapter covers advanced DMG graphics functionalities, such as horizontal blanking, that weren’t covered in the previous chapters. You’ll start by learning about the LCD modes and how you can access the VRAM even outside the vblank.
Then you’ll see implementations of a few advanced techniques that allow you to enhance the graphics of your programs, such as parallax scrolling, which creates the illusion of depth with 2D graphics, and a palette trick to create nice screen transitions between menus or scenes in your programs.
Next, you’ll learn about direct memory access, a hardware feature that shortens the duration of OAM updates dramatically, giving you more time in the vblank to implement additional graphics effects. ...
